As the 21st century opens, the explosive situation in the Korean Peninsula seems poised to upset peace and security in NE Asia and the rest of the world. This study explores the political, economic and military fragility of the two Koreas, analyzing the causes of this persistant Cold War.
As Korea enters a hopeful new chapter in its history, this timely book, with contributions by distinguished experts in the field, addresses the fragility of the political, economic, and military balance within the two Koreas and in Northeast Asia. It provides in-depth analysis of the principal factors that gave rise to the persisting Cold War on the Korean peninsula, and successfully unravels many aspects of the complicated domestic and economic dynamics of the two Koreas, the patterns of relationship between the two rival states, as well as their changing relationships with the United States and other major powers.
